Understanding the Firminator G3's Design and Technology:

The Firminator G3 boasts a unique design aimed at minimizing shedding and maximizing comfort for both the pet and the owner. The core technology lies in its patented stainless steel undercoat rake. Unlike regular brushes, this rake penetrates deep into the undercoat, targeting loose hair and dead skin that traditional brushes often miss. The teeth are carefully spaced and angled to efficiently remove the undercoat without causing discomfort or damaging the topcoat.

Several key features distinguish the G3 from its predecessors and competitors:

  • Ergonomic Handle: The redesigned handle offers a more comfortable and secure grip, reducing hand fatigue during extended grooming sessions. This is particularly beneficial for larger breeds or pets with thick coats.

  • FURminator deShedding Tool: The G3 features a redesigned, more efficient rake that’s better at capturing loose hair. The increased efficiency reduces the time spent grooming.

  • Safety Features: While designed to remove undercoat effectively, the G3 incorporates safety measures to prevent skin irritation. The teeth are rounded to minimize scratching and potential harm to the pet's skin.

  • Easy-to-Clean: Cleaning the Firminator G3 is straightforward. A simple push of a button releases the rake, allowing for quick and easy removal of collected hair. This prevents clogging and ensures continued optimal performance.

Benefits of Using the Firminator G3:

The Firminator G3 offers several notable advantages:

  • Reduced Shedding: The primary benefit is a significant reduction in shedding around the house. This translates to less cleaning, less hair on furniture and clothing, and a cleaner living environment overall.

  • Improved Coat Health: Removing the dead undercoat improves the overall health and appearance of the pet's coat. It promotes better air circulation, reduces matting, and can even alleviate skin irritations caused by trapped dead hair.

  • Increased Pet Comfort: By removing the heavy undercoat, pets often experience increased comfort, especially during warmer months. A lighter, cleaner coat helps regulate their body temperature.

  • Bonding Experience: Regular grooming sessions with the Firminator G3 can strengthen the bond between pet and owner. It provides a dedicated time for interaction and care.

Drawbacks and Potential Considerations:

Despite its numerous advantages, the Firminator G3 isn't without potential drawbacks:

  • Potential for Irritation: While generally safe, using the Firminator G3 incorrectly can lead to skin irritation or discomfort for the pet. It's crucial to follow the manufacturer's instructions carefully and avoid excessive force.

  • Cost: The Firminator G3 is a relatively expensive grooming tool compared to standard brushes.

  • Not Suitable for All Breeds: While effective for many breeds, the Firminator G3 isn't ideal for all dogs and cats. Short-haired breeds might not benefit as much, and certain breeds with sensitive skin may require a gentler approach.

  • Maintenance: While cleaning is relatively easy, regular maintenance is still required to ensure optimal performance.

Proper Usage and Tips:

To maximize the benefits and minimize potential drawbacks of the Firminator G3, follow these tips:

  • Start Slowly: Introduce the tool gradually to your pet, allowing them to get used to the sensation. Short grooming sessions are better than prolonged ones, especially initially.

  • Use Gentle Strokes: Avoid excessive pressure. The tool should glide smoothly across the coat, not dig into the skin.

  • Follow the Grain: Brush in the direction of hair growth to minimize irritation.

  • Regular Cleaning: Clean the tool after each use to prevent clogging and maintain its effectiveness.

  • Consult a Veterinarian: If you notice any signs of skin irritation or discomfort, consult your veterinarian.
